Committee members said the district lacks a specific policy on artificial intelligence and asked staff to begin developing interim guidance and an advisory process for staff and student use; the committee referenced recent regional discussions and potential legal questions raised by use of AI in student work.

Committee members flagged artificial intelligence (AI) as a priority for policy development and directed staff to begin work this year to provide interim guidance for educators and students.
